**Action item (from the Quillgate outage review):** The metrics-aggregation sidecar, Tallyhop, was buffering unbounded when the collector went dark, which is how we chewed through pod memory in twelve minutes. Fix is to cap the buffer and add jittered backoff — nothing fancy, but the caps need security sign-off since they gate what we drop first. Here are the proposed tuning constants for review.

tuning table, kajog-kawef:
PRIORITIES = {
    "kelox": 870,
    "kasix": 89,
    "eliax": 988,
}

# Constants for the Tallykeep audit-log viewer.
#
# The viewer paginates over an append-only event store and hydrates
# actor names lazily to keep first paint fast. Page size, hydration
# batch size, and the stale-cursor cutoff interact: raising one
# without the others shifts load to the hydration service. Reviewers
# should sanity-check any change against the capacity notes in the
# runbook. The tuning constants follow.

tuning constants:
QUOTAS = {
    "druwyn": 5,
    "holix": 5,
    "zorath": 5,
    "holwyn": 10,
}

### 3.1.0 — ORM Refactor

Replaced the legacy Fernlake ORM adapter with the new repository layer. Query builders moved to `core/persistence`; old session helpers are deprecated but shimmed until 4.0. Migration scripts are idempotent and logged. Future maintainers should read the mapping notes before touching entity caches. Questions about this refactor should go to the engineer named below.

account owner for bawip-tahag: Raleth Quenok

Nightly build of Calendra failed signature verification after the date-format localization patch landed. The locale bundle regeneration changed the artifact hash but the pipeline re-signed with a stale key from the Hollowbrook runner cache. Fix: purge the cache and re-sign with the current release key. For reference, the correct signing key is below.

rollout seal: bky4_DFM9

TURN-208: Gatevale turnstile counters at the Merrow Field pilot double-count when a rotation reverses mid-cycle. Attendance totals drift roughly 2% high per event. The debounce window fix is implemented, reviewed by Ilsa, and soak-tested across two simulated match days without drift. Ready for your cut; the candidate build is identified below.

trace token, tagag-tafog: htk6_5ed18c